A unique simulation framework offering detailed analysis of energy storage systems. Different storage technologies are covered including aging phenomenons. Various system components are modeled which can be configured to a desired topology. The tool offers configurable energy management and power distribution strategies.
These elements are crucial for evaluating energy storage systems as a whole. In order to provide insights into the overall system behavior, SimSES not only models the periphery and the EMS, it also provides in-depth technical and economical analysis of the investigated ESS.
At the present time, energy storage systems (ESS) are becoming more and more widespread as part of electric power systems (EPS). Extensive capabilities of ESS make them one of the key elements of future energy systems [1, 2].
Part iā Energy storage systems are increasingly used as part of electric power systems to solve various problems of power supply reliability. With increasing power of the energy storage systems and the share of their use in electric power systems, their influence on operation modes and transient processes becomes significant.
System periphery, management, and evaluation Energy storage systems not only consist of the underlying storage technology but also the periphery like power electronic components and thermal behavior as well as an EMS. These elements are crucial for evaluating energy storage systems as a whole.
In this case study, three different storage systems are simulated: a LIB system with 150 kWh, a RFB system with 200 kWh, and a hybrid system with 10 kWh LIB capacity and 180 kWh RFB capacity. More detail on the system configuration chosen for this case study is given in Fig. 10.
